Reserve Police Officers are trained volunteers that are sworn in and given law enforcement authority. Some are seeking knowledge and experience to prepare them to achieve a full-time paid position. Others volunteer to show a personal commitment to the community.

The purpose of this program is to allow a property owner or manager to authorize officers to enter onto their property for the purpose of enforcing trespass laws against individuals who are trespassing on the property when there is no responsible party on site.
The McMinnville Police Department’s Honor Guard was established in 2008. The six members of the Honor Guard detail wear specially designed, formal uniforms that pay tribute to the national and state flags they bear.

The purpose of this program is to allow business owners or managers to report cold shoplift/theft/criminal mischief incidents and submit their report, along with any evidence, to the police department for follow up.
